WASHINGTON, D.C. – Georgetown University sophomore alexia Araujo-Dagba is currently in São Paulo,Brazil,training with the Brazilian U19 Women’s National Team as they prepare for the FIBA U19 Women’s basketball World Cup,scheduled to take place in Brno,Czech Republic,from July 12-20. Araujo-Dagba is among the 17 players competing for a final roster spot adn is one of seven collegiate athletes on the provisional team.
Araujo-Dagba’s journey to the World Cup
The Brazilian U19 team has been engaged in intensive training in São Paulo since mid-June. Before heading to the Czech Republic, the team will travel to Croatia on July 6 for kind matches on July 8 and 9. The World Cup will see Brazil compete in Group C against formidable opponents including australia, France, and Mali.
Brazil secured its place in the tournament after finishing fourth in the 2024 U18 Copa américa, marking their second consecutive qualification. The team previously triumphed at the U17 South American championship in Bucaramanga,Colombia,in 2023.

International Experience and Collegiate career
Araujo-Dagba has been a consistent presence in the Brazilian national team program since 2021, participating in six international tournaments. She has played in 33 FIBA games,averaging 5.9 points and 3.7 rebounds per game.In her most recent tournament, she averaged 11.7 points and 6.7 rebounds across six games, highlighted by an 18-point, 10-rebound double-double against Argentina in the third-place game.
During her freshman year at Georgetown, Araujo-Dagba played in 24 games, averaging 2.1 points and 1.8 rebounds. She recorded a double-double in her debut game, scoring 10 points and grabbing 10 rebounds.
